Noise when starting-stopping

Hi Guys!

Greetings from Italy!

I ask you an opinion about a noise I hear from the rear of my Z4. When my car has a sudden acceleration or braking I hear a soft "clunk" noise from the rear. It seems located on the right side. It may occurs when I depart from a standstill or, moving slowly, I accelerate suddenly or when I brake to go to a soft stop, I hear the "clunk" when the car is almost at standstill.

It is very noticeable when moving out from a parking, say, I shift from Rear gear to forward and I accelerate when the car is still moving backwards.

It seems to me something loose in the transmission that produces this noise every time some torque is applied on. The car is a 2009-built unit and has now 8990 km.
